Hourly to Project Rate Converter ni nini?

The Hourly to Project Rate Converter helps freelancers and consultants convert hourly rates into project-based fixed pricing that properly accounts for time buffer (project overrun risk), overhead (your business costs), and profit margin. Hourly billing has limited upside; project-based pricing rewards efficiency. The calculator outputs the recommended project rate and effective hourly rate, helping you transition from time-billing to value-billing.

Fomula

Project Rate = (Hourly × Hours) × (1 + Buffer%) × (1 + Overhead%) × (1 + Profit%)

Mwongozo wa Hatua kwa Hatua

  1. 1Enter your standard hourly rate
  2. 2Enter estimated project hours
  3. 3Set buffer percentage (20% typical, covers scope creep)
  4. 4Set overhead percentage (15% typical, covers tools/admin/taxes)
  5. 5Set profit margin (20%+ typical for project work)
  6. 6Calculator outputs project rate and effective hourly

Mifano Iliyotatuliwa

Ingizo
$75/hr × 40hr, 20% buffer, 15% overhead, 20% profit
Matokeo
$3,000 base → $4,320 project rate, $108 effective hourly

Makosa ya Kawaida ya Kuepuka

  • Quoting project rate equal to hourly × hours (no buffer/profit)
  • Underestimating project hours by 30-50%
  • Forgetting overhead and taxes

Maswali yanayoulizwa mara kwa mara

Should I always do project pricing?

Project pricing works best when scope is clear and you can deliver efficiently. Hourly works better for ongoing/unclear scope. Many freelancers offer both with project pricing for defined work, hourly for retainer.
